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 pounds ground beef or turkey
  • 2 large onions, thinly sliced
  • 1 cup breadcrumbs (gluten-free optional)
  • ½ cup shredded cheese (Swiss or Gruyere)
  • 1 large egg
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on thyme
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Caramelize the onions in olive oil over medium heat for about 20-25 minutes until golden brown.
  2. In a large bowl, mix ground beef (or turkey), breadcrumbs, shredded cheese, egg, garlic powder, thyme, salt, pepper, and cooled onions until well combined.
  3. Shape the mixture into a loaf on a lined baking sheet or in a loaf pan.
  4.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C) and bake for 50-60 minutes until the internal temperature reaches 160°F (71°C).
  5. Let it rest for 5-10 minutes before slicing to retain moisture.


Nutrition

  • Serving Size: 1 slice (approximately 140g)
  • Calories: 350
  • Sugar: 4g
  • Sodium: 600mg
  • Fat: 20g
  • Saturated Fat: 9g
  • Unsaturated Fat: 10g
  • Trans Fat: 0g
  • Carbohydrates: 18g
  • Fiber: 2g
  • Protein: 28g
  • Cholesterol: 100mg
